1. Caffè Sant’Eustachio

Located near the stunning Pantheon, Caffè Sant’Eustachio is a legendary institution in Rome, known for its exceptional coffee. The cafe has been serving locals and tourists alike since 1937, and its secret recipe has remained unchanged for over 80 years. Their iced coffee, known as “gran caffè freddo,” is a heavenly concoction of espresso, sugar, and a generous amount of crushed ice. The result is a magical blend of flavors that will awaken your taste buds and cool you down on a hot summer day.

3. Antico Caffè Greco

As one of the oldest cafes in Rome, Antico Caffè Greco is a true institution. Located near the Spanish Steps, this historic cafe has been frequented by artists, writers, and intellectuals for centuries. Step inside and be transported back in time, as you marvel at the elegant decor and antique furnishings. While their menu offers a variety of hot and cold beverages, their iced coffee is a must-try. Sip on their perfectly chilled espresso, and soak in the ambiance of this iconic cafe.
